UFC 329: Luke Riley's Controversial Knockout | Pros React to Early Stoppage (2026)

The recent UFC 329 event has sparked a heated debate among fans and fighters alike, with the controversial knockout of Kai Kamaka III by Luke Riley taking center stage. The stoppage, which came just 3:03 into the first round, left many in the MMA community questioning the referee's decision. While Riley secured a significant win, improving his record to 14-0 as a professional and 3-0 in the UFC, the aftermath of the fight has been dominated by criticism and concern.

The controversy lies in the timing of the stoppage. As Riley was battering a retreating Kamaka, the referee, Kerry Hatley, stepped in to end the fight. This move was met with skepticism from several prominent UFC fighters, who believed Kamaka was still capable of continuing the bout. Billy Quarantillo, a fellow featherweight, expressed his disapproval, stating, 'That stoppage sucked.' This sentiment was echoed by Josh Hokit, Jamahal Hill, and Matt Frevola, who all questioned why Hatley didn't allow Kamaka more time to recover.

The debate surrounding this incident highlights the delicate balance between ensuring fighter safety and maintaining the integrity of the sport. While the intention behind the stoppage was undoubtedly to protect Kamaka from further harm, the execution has raised eyebrows. The fact that Kamaka was visibly dazed but attempting to clinch Riley suggests that he was not completely out of the fight.
